Uranium Mill Tailings. Uranium mill tailings are primarily the sandy process waste material from a conventional uranium mill.This ore residue contains the radioactive decay products from the uranium chains mainly the U-238 chain and heavy metals. After uranium ore is removed from the ground, it must be processed to extract the contained uranium. This process, "milling," involves a sequence of physical and chemical treatment steps to extract the uranium from the native rock. The final product of milling is yellowcake or U 3 O 8, which is the commercial product sold by uranium ...

Mill chemistry. The crushed and ground ore, or the underground ore in the case of ISL mining, is leached with sulfuric acid: UO 3 + 2H + ====> UO 2 2+ + H 2 O UO 2 2+ + 3SO 4 2-====> UO 2 (SO 4) 3 4-. The UO 2 is oxidised to UO 3.. With some ores, carbonate leaching is used to form a soluble uranyl tricarbonate ion: UO 2 (CO 3) 3 4-.This can then be precipitated with an alkali, e.g. as sodium ...

What are the Radioactive Byproducts of Depleted Uranium ...

When uranium ore is extracted from the earth, most of the uranium is removed from the crushed rock during the milling process, but the radioactive decay products are left in the tailings. Thus 85 percent of the radioactivity of the original ore is discarded in the mill tailings.

(front mill, mid Ace-Fay-Verna east head frame, rear landing strip) Uranium milling in Saskatchewan's Athabasca Basin began at Rabbit Lake in 1975. The Rabbit Lake mill processed ore from four open pit mines, Rabbit Lake, A-zone, B-zone and D-zone. Currently the mill is fed by the Eagle Point underground mine. The initial milling process at
